A number of conjugative plasmids of opportunistic E. coli with molecular weights of 23.6--81.8 megadaltons have been studied. On the basis of the data thus obtained conjugative F-like R-plastmids have been subdivided into 2 groups characterized by the unsuppressed or suppressed manifestation of their functions. Individual conjugative plasmids have been found to differ in their capacity for mobilizing non-conjugative SuSm plasmid for transfer, which indicates the possibility of using this test for characterization and classification of plasmids, identified in natural bacterial population.
